I make a sweet and sour type sauce just using pasata, sweetener, vinegar and soy sauce. It can be a bit trial and error getting the quantities right but if you keep tasting it you can get it how you like it.
 
I add garlic, chilli and ginger to mine. Then just at the end I put a bit of very low fat natural yoghurt in. Gives it a slight creamy taste and its syn free!

Chinese five spice, soy sauce, rice wine vinegar, garlic and ginger paste and a very small knob of butter or a couple of sprays of butter frylight.

Throw it all in the pan and heat through for a couple of seconds and then add your veggies.

Simple but quite tasty :)
